Last year, Nabisco/MondelΔz eliminated 600 good, middle-class jobs in Chicago in order to outsource Nabisco production to Mexico. And while workers in Mexico are paid only $1 per hour, MondelΔz CEO Irene Rosenfeld averages nearly $20 million per year.
So on May 17, when company decision makers gather for the annual MondelΔz Shareholders Meeting in Lincolnshire, Ill., BCTGM Nabisco/MondelΔz workers, BCTGM local unions, supporters and activists will be there to protest the companyβs failed business model that destroys American jobs, exploits workers,Β and devastates communities.
